Partnerships in Child Care Teacher Institute

All Lead Teachers in Type III child care centers are required by the Louisiana Department of Education to have a Louisiana Early Childhood Ancillary Certificate from a state-approved program like our PICC Teacher Institute.
What is the Teacher Institute?
This exciting and supportive training program will begin its next cohort August 2023 - May 2024. Participants will complete 135 hours of coursework and receive step-by-step support to earn the CDA and the Louisiana Early Childhood Ancillary Certificate! The Teacher Institute is approved by the Louisiana Board of Elementary and Secondary Education (BESE).
Who is eligible for the Teacher Institute?
Lead Teachers at Type III child care centers and registered family child care providers. Providers from all Greater Baton Rouge parishes are eligible to apply ( Ascension, East Baton Rouge, East Feliciana, Iberville, Livingston, St. Helena, Tangipahoa, West Baton Rouge, West Feliciana).
When do Teacher Institute classes take place?
Classes are held Face to Face or virtually every Tuesday from 5 - 8 p.m and some Thursdays 5 – 8 p.m. Beginning in August and ending in May. If classes convert to face-to-face, all classes will be held in the Greater Baton Rouge area.
